Abstrak:
The purpose of this study was to find out about the early observation of visual-spatial intelligence at RA Rahmatullah Tanjung Morawa. The results of the observation were seen during security activities, children were involved in drawing activities freely. From here, it can be observed that some children have shown good development in visual spatial intelligence. This can be seen from their ability to draw objects around them and combine colors to create images that match their vision. This study aims to explain the results of the study on the development of children's visual spatial intelligence. The type of research adopted in this study is qualitative research. The method chosen in this study is qualitative with a type of phenomenological research, which is intended to explore the phenomena that occur in the school environment to provide the information needed. From the results of the study obtained through observation and interviews with class teachers of group B at RA Rahmatullah Tanjung Morawa, it can be seen that the development of children's visual spatial intelligence in group B has developed well. The intelligence possessed by children is shown by their ability to perceive the visual world, namely the ability to capture and mix colors when coloring, their pleasure in drawing and doodling, imagining, making simple designs, and the ability to understand direction and shape, and also in creating various shapes.
